LANSING, Mich. — Kelli Ellsworth Etchison, second from left, was honored at the recent annual convention of the Michigan Credit Union League (MCUL) as the MCUL 2014 Credit Union Youth Advocate of the Year.
Ellsworth Etchison is LAFCU vice president of community and business development. Also pictured, from left, are David Adams, MCUL president & CEO, Harold Foster, LAFCU Board of Directors president, and Patrick Spyke, LAFCU executive vice president.
This Youth Advocate achievement recognizes a Michigan credit union employee for outstanding contributions that serve youths. Ellsworth Etchison has led the development of several innovative youth outreach efforts, products and services for the mid-Michigan credit union that dramatically expanded during 2014.
